Wildcat House Yamanekoken
The restaurant is based on Kenji's fairy tale ``The Restaurant with Many Orders,'' and you can enjoy a variety of different flavors of rice cakes prepared by local mothers. You can also try other local dishes such as ``hitsumi'' and ``suiton with mixed grains.'' We also sell souvenirs such as Kenji goods. You can also try Wanko Soba at Ginga Plaza Yamanekoken, which is directly across from Shin-Hanamaki Station. (Reservation required)
